Been a while, suggestions for a reader?

As the subject implies, it's been quite a while since I was looking for a reader. I've currently got the Sony PRS-300 which I've been pretty happy with, especially for the size. Storage space limitations don't bother me, it's far more than I need to carry a ton of books around with me.

However, lately it feels like the battery life may be waning a bit, and its CPU takes forever when I first open a book to render/flow everything out, and *deity* help me if I accidentally hit the zoom button, takes forever because I need to go from S->M->L->S again.

Anyway, logically the PRS-350 would be my upgrade device, but is there anything with some faster page turns? The 0.7s doesn't bug me too much, but if there's faster I'll take it. I saw the Bookeen Cybook Opus, which according to the Reader Matrix has a 0.1s page turn mode. Huh? Does this actually work as specified and does it still give me good quality text?
